BURNING AMP 2016 LUNCH MENU

At Burning Amp 2015 the lunch was a real hit with attendees so we are again planning on catering Indian Food. I finally have some info about this critical aspect of the event and wanted to share what is in store. This should be even better than last year with more variety in offerings. The menu will include:
  • Appetizers: Samosas
  • Mixed spring greens salad (with dressing)
  • Assorted Naan (3-4 types)
  • Vegetarian main courses (2-3 options)
  • Non-Vegetarian main courses (2-3 options)
  • Dessert (e.g. Kheer)
The cost will be $10 per person with lunch tickets available the day of the event.
